Kako attends the same school that current Bombers excitement machine Nate Caddy attended last year.

And he is excited to potentially “link up together on the big stage” with Caddy in the red and black.

“It would be pretty good to link up with him again and share the big stage,” he said.

“We’re real good mates and have played a lot of footy together. We were a dynamic duo back in high school kicking bags of goals together.

“We’re pretty close mates and still stay in touch. I ask him a lot of questions, he’s got a wealth of knowledge now, I’ve been picking away at his brain and he’s been really good.”
